> Coolview is a patched version of an ancient Cygwin DLL (circa
> B18)
> that Sergey Okhapkin kept for a while.  It had some limited
> capabilities
> for creating and using file names in a case-sensitive manner. 
> It's old
> enough to be irrelevant to all but the staunchest of diehards.
>  Those
> interested in the tradeoffsof  case-sensitive tools may find
> it interesting
> to review the email archives on this subject.  But Randall is
> quite right.
> You won't get anything here without some pain and suffering.
